"Time to Get Tough was Trump's current book"
True

Published by Regnery Publishing in 2011, debuted #27 on NYT bestseller list, functioned as prelude to exploratory 2012 presidential campaign

"Trump had '2012 plans' (presidential campaign)"
Half True

Trump explored 2012 presidential run during this period (book tour functioned as campaign preparation), but ultimately declined to run in May 2012. Statement technically accurate but ambiguous about level of commitment.
